數(shù)控編程中加刀補(bǔ)是確保加工精度和效率的關(guān)鍵步驟。刀補(bǔ)的作用在于根據(jù)刀具的實(shí)際位置與編程時(shí)設(shè)定位置的偏差進(jìn)行調(diào)整,從而使加工出來的零件達(dá)到預(yù)定的尺寸和形狀。本文將從專業(yè)角度詳細(xì)闡述數(shù)控編程中刀補(bǔ)的添加方法。
一、刀補(bǔ)的概念及分類
刀補(bǔ),即刀具補(bǔ)償,是數(shù)控編程中用來調(diào)整刀具實(shí)際位置與編程位置偏差的一種技術(shù)。根據(jù)補(bǔ)償?shù)姆绞?,刀補(bǔ)可分為正向補(bǔ)償和反向補(bǔ)償兩種。
1. 正向補(bǔ)償:刀具實(shí)際位置在編程位置之前,通過正向補(bǔ)償使刀具實(shí)際位置后移,以消除刀具位置偏差。
2. 反向補(bǔ)償:刀具實(shí)際位置在編程位置之后,通過反向補(bǔ)償使刀具實(shí)際位置前移,以消除刀具位置偏差。
二、刀補(bǔ)的添加方法
1. 確定刀補(bǔ)類型
根據(jù)刀具實(shí)際位置與編程位置的關(guān)系,選擇合適的刀補(bǔ)類型。若刀具實(shí)際位置在編程位置之前,則選擇正向補(bǔ)償;若刀具實(shí)際位置在編程位置之后,則選擇反向補(bǔ)償。
2. 設(shè)置刀補(bǔ)參數(shù)
在數(shù)控系統(tǒng)中,刀補(bǔ)參數(shù)包括刀補(bǔ)值、刀補(bǔ)方向等。刀補(bǔ)值是指刀具實(shí)際位置與編程位置之間的偏差值;刀補(bǔ)方向是指刀具實(shí)際位置相對(duì)于編程位置的方向。
(1)刀補(bǔ)值的確定
刀補(bǔ)值的確定需要根據(jù)實(shí)際加工情況進(jìn)行分析。以下幾種情況需要設(shè)置刀補(bǔ)值:
①刀具安裝誤差:由于刀具安裝時(shí)的誤差,導(dǎo)致刀具實(shí)際位置與編程位置存在偏差,需要設(shè)置刀補(bǔ)值。
②工件安裝誤差:工件安裝時(shí)的誤差,導(dǎo)致工件實(shí)際位置與編程位置存在偏差,需要設(shè)置刀補(bǔ)值。
③刀具磨損:刀具使用過程中發(fā)生磨損,導(dǎo)致刀具實(shí)際位置與編程位置存在偏差,需要設(shè)置刀補(bǔ)值。
(2)刀補(bǔ)方向的設(shè)置
刀補(bǔ)方向的設(shè)置需要根據(jù)刀具實(shí)際位置與編程位置的關(guān)系進(jìn)行。若刀具實(shí)際位置在編程位置之前,則設(shè)置正向補(bǔ)償;若刀具實(shí)際位置在編程位置之后,則設(shè)置反向補(bǔ)償。
3. 編寫刀補(bǔ)程序
在數(shù)控編程軟件中,根據(jù)刀補(bǔ)類型、刀補(bǔ)參數(shù)等信息編寫刀補(bǔ)程序。以下是一個(gè)簡(jiǎn)單的刀補(bǔ)程序示例:
G21 G90 G17 X0 Y0 Z0 ; 選擇絕對(duì)編程、絕對(duì)坐標(biāo)和XY平面
G96 S1200 M3 ; 設(shè)定主軸轉(zhuǎn)速和方向
G54 ; 調(diào)用刀具補(bǔ)償
G00 X50 Y50 Z100 ; 快速定位到加工起點(diǎn)
G01 X50 Y50 Z0 F200 ; 精加工輪廓
G53 G90 G17 X0 Y0 Z0 ; 返回參考點(diǎn)
M30 ; 程序結(jié)束
4. 校驗(yàn)刀補(bǔ)效果
在實(shí)際加工前,需要對(duì)刀補(bǔ)效果進(jìn)行校驗(yàn)。校驗(yàn)方法如下:
(1)觀察刀具與工件的接觸情況,確保刀具與工件接觸良好。
(2)使用測(cè)量工具測(cè)量加工出的零件尺寸,與編程尺寸進(jìn)行對(duì)比,確保加工精度。
通過以上步驟,即可在數(shù)控編程中添加刀補(bǔ),確保加工精度和效率。在實(shí)際操作中,應(yīng)根據(jù)具體情況進(jìn)行調(diào)整,以達(dá)到最佳加工效果。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。